#d0f892 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d0f892 is composed of 81.6% red, 97.3%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.1%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 83.5 degrees, a saturation of 87.9% and a lightness of 77.3%. #d0f892 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a1f125.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

● #d0f892 color description : Very soft green.
#d0f892 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d0f892 has RGB values of R:208, G:248,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 13695122.

Shades and Tints of #d0f892
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010200 is the darkest color, while #f8feee is the lightest one.

Tones of #d0f892
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c5c7c3 is the less saturated color, while #d1fc8e is the most saturated one.
